9:00, last night, i was watching TV and i came across this documentary about the real evidence for Moses and the Exodus (bible story for those who dont know). The story included a few parts that many thought were just made up and superstistion, but this program acually scientifically explained any of the "mircale" parts of the story.

First of all being how God lead the Isralites by a pillar of smoke by day, and a pillar of fire by night. You see, it is belived that all this hapened at the same time that a massive volcanic island in the mediterranian errupted. It put it simply, it was huge, the ash and dust rose maybe 50km into the air, and that would have been visable from Egypt, thats a pillar of smoke outa the way.

Now, at night, the ash and dust would have been loaded with static electricity and would have been great conductors for lightning and thunder, while Moses would have been to far away to hear the thunder, he almost certainly would have seen the lightning, which would have given the ash a "Flaming Effect" Neat eh?

I doubt they knew that somewhere in the mediterrain sea, a couple of hundred kms away that some island exploded, but they would have seen the pillar of ash and dust, they wouldnt have known what it was (this is dated like 1600 BC btw) so they tried to understand by making a explaination (aka God).

Anyway, onto the crossing of the sea.

First off - parting the Red sea, impossibe. During translations of the bible, "Reed" was mis-traslated as "Red'. The "Reed" sea is area of the Nile Delta, about 5m deep at its deepest point and was surrounded by reeds. Anyway, the volcanic explosion refered to above caused the island to sink, creating a tsumani, now when you look at a wave at the beach, you will notice what just before a wave brakes, the water at the shoreline retreats into the wave itself. (Meh, not a very good explaination i know)

Same thing happens on a bigger scale, Moses and his crew came to the Reed Sea and the Tsumani drew the water from the sea in, leaving a path for them to go by. Pharoah follows, Tsumani strikes - all dead (BTW this was far enough inland that the waters would only run through the seabed.

Although the waters didnt rise to make a path for them, this might have been added to make the story sound better.
